Transaction e73599a3240ece5233c88baa143afe065027e88929da2d3575295adc2932ac32
1 Input
-
7b54226daca8604c9a55437c7992b4be7cd60c3c2950e1649b153467ff4c9baa:74
OP_DATA_48(48) 44022050681f3bc1c10229d859d2f7778610fc7fefab1302a6f01a001ddeed538d3e0902202264aa433d2b64d3d0fe6e
1 Outputs
- e73599a3240ece5233c88baa143afe065027e88929da2d3575295adc2932ac32:0
value 564937
address 3FwF8Lkiw2yUSmUoxgGQKHTtkfqFrgHAyV